"I'm such a fan of Eco Fashion World and though I'd contribute a street style image of my own. This photo was taken by Mark Andrew Boyer in Chicago, IL.
Here's the description for the photo:
'm wearing Greenbees boots, which are made with recycled car tires. I found the bag at a western wear store in Buffalo, NY and I'm also wearing a vegetable ivory ring by muichic. I get really excited about the innovative materials designers are using to make stylish and eco-friendly clothing - it feels like such a good investment. Other brands I'm into right now are NAU, SUST and Sublet. "

This picture is taken at Punta del Arbol in the south of Chili. Since I am working there, I have been collecting beautiful ethical pieces of local designers. Like the scarf I'm wearing here made out of raw sheep wool by an artesan who delivers products to www.mandalapatagonia.com. The ring I'm wearing is a turquoise stone in silver made by a designer in Puerto Natales (Chili). I am a long standing vintage fan, so most of the other items I'm wearing here are either second hand or vintage

Mia wearing A QUESTION OF T-shirt at the street in Copenhagen . The T-shirt made in Africa under the terms of Fair Trade out of organic cotton. (see www.aquestionof.dk for more information)
